Position Summary: We are looking for an energetic and highly organized  Office Manager to lead the day-to-day operations of our fast-paced New York office. As the face of e.l.f. on-site, you’ll play a key role in creating a welcoming, efficient, well-maintained and functioning work environment. From greeting guests, managing vendors and facilities, to ordering and restocking supplies, this role requires someone proactive, hands-on, and detail-oriented with a strong sense of ownership.

Responsibilities:

  • Serve as the first point of contact for visitors and employees; provide coverage for the front
    desk as needed
  • Oversee cleanliness, maintenance, and organization of all shared office spaces, including
    kitchens, conference rooms, and restrooms
  • Manage office supply inventory, food/beverage orders, and weekly catering for Thursday
    office lunch
  • Maintain and organize the e.l.f. product room, including inventory tracking and
    replenishment from warehouse
  • Handle all incoming and outgoing mail and package logistics, including FedEx and
    courier services
  • Act as a leader in culture
  • Plan and execute internal events including happy hours, celebrations, and company-wide
    meetings based on Oakland HQ’s direction
  • Act as the liaison with building management, HVAC, IT, cleaning vendor, plant care and
    other vendors
  • Help IT troubleshoot office equipment and tech issues (WiFi, A/V, printers, etc.) to
    ensure smooth daily operations
  • Partner with the Oakland office team to align on company-wide policies and practices
  • Manage office budgets, purchase orders, and invoice tracking in collaboration with
    Accounting
  • Ensure fire safety compliance; serve as Fire Warden
    Lead ad hoc office projects and serve as a trusted, go-to resource for the NY team
  • Support office construction teams as the on-site point person

Requirements:

  • 2–5 years of experience in office management or facilities operations, preferably in a
    fast-paced environment (50+ employees)
  • Exceptionally organized with strong attention to detail and follow-through
  • Warm, professional, and approachable demeanor with a solution-oriented mindset
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ite; comfortable using digital tools and internal systems
  •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s
  • High school diploma required; bachelor’s degree preferred

About E.L.F. BEAUTY

e.l.f. Beauty, Inc. stands with every eye, lip, face and paw. Celebrating the beauty of every eye, lip and face is fundamental to our DNA. It’s in our name and inspires us as a company. We are committed to creating a culture internally – and in the world around us – where all individuals are encouraged to express their truest selves, are empowered to succeed and where we do the right thing for people, the planet and animals.


Our deep commitment to inclusive, accessible, cruelty-free beauty has fueled the success of the e.l.f. Cosmetics brand online and at retail since 2004. With the 2020 acquisition of the pioneering clean-beauty brand W3LL People, and the new lifestyle beauty brand Keys Soulcare created with Alicia Keys, we continue to strategically expand our portfolio with brands that support our purpose and values. Our six brands — e.l.f. Cosmetics, e.l.f. SKIN, W3LL People, Keys Soulcare, NATURIUM and rhode — are widely available online, and at leading beauty, mass-market, and natural specialty retailers.
